Danotek to double staff next year

Danotek Motion Industries LLC is generating more than power - the company will double its eight-member staff in the next year, adding a total of 141 employees over the next five years, says business manager Carla Glaze.

The company makes permanent magnet generators, power control electronics and brushless motors for power generation industries and advance automotive applications.

The company is also relocating from Ann Arbor to a larger facility in Pittsfield Township, Glaze says - the scale of the generators means Danotek requires more space.

"The move will happen first quarter of next year, so fairly soon," she says. "In terms of the hiring... we're slated to at least double in the next year."

The positions Danotek will fill range from technical to engineering to professional and administrative, but "focused mainly on the technical," Glaze says. "In addition, we'll be hiring people to do assembly and manufacturing."

The company has received a $2.3 million state tax abatement, and is expected to receive a $41,600, seven-year tax credit from Pittsfield Township.

Danotek is in a win-win situation, she says - one of few companies building permanent magnet generators, a fast-growing field.
